The Food Lion Feeds Charitable Foundation recently announced it is donating $315,000 to fund local hunger-relief initiatives through 18 regional food bank partners and its national hunger-relief partner, Feeding America®. The Foundation is donating $165,000 for child hunger programs, and $150,000 for innovative, military-focused hunger-relief initiatives.
